A recent trip to Skipton (UK – North) lead to me the Craven Museum and an exhibition of paintings by Roo Waterhouse. The paintings depicted toys through each of the decades from the 1930s – 1980s.
Alongside the paintings were a collection of the toys,  some of which I have not seen for years but recalled from my own childhood. Also I’m a huge fan of classic toys (a big kid) so this was amazing to see.
